What is ombre hair?
Ombre hair is a type of hair coloring that creates a gradual blend from one color to another. The most common type of ombre hair is a dark color at the roots that fades to a lighter color at the ends. However, there are many different variations of ombre hair, so you can find a look that suits your style.
What are the different types of ombre hair?
There are many different types of ombre hair, but some of the most popular include:
- Classic ombre: This is the most common type of ombre hair, and it features a dark color at the roots that fades to a lighter color at the ends.
- Reverse ombre: With reverse ombre, the lighter color is at the roots and the darker color is at the ends.
- Multi-color ombre: This type of ombre hair features multiple colors, such as blue, purple, and pink.
- Balayage ombre: Balayage is a type of ombre hair that is created by hand-painting the color onto the hair. This creates a more natural-looking ombre effect.

How to care for your ombre bob
Ombre bobs are relatively easy to care for. Here are a few tips:
- Use a shampoo and conditioner that is designed for colored hair.
- Avoid using heat styling tools on your hair too often.
- Get regular trims to keep your hair looking its best.
FAQs
Q: How long does it take to get an ombre bob?
A: The amount of time it takes to get an ombre bob will vary depending on the length of your hair and the complexity of the style. However, most ombre bobs can be done in about two hours.
Q: How much does it cost to get an ombre bob?
A: The cost of an ombre bob will vary depending on the salon you go to and the length of your hair. However, most ombre bobs cost between $100 and $200.
Q: How often do I need to get my ombre bob touched up?
A: The frequency with which you need to get your ombre bob touched up will depend on how quickly your hair grows. However, most ombre bobs need to be touched up every six to eight weeks.
